#dea438 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#dea438 is composed of 87.1% red, 64.3%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.1% magenta, 74.8%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 39 degrees, a saturation of 71.6% and a lightness of 54.5%. #dea438 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#bd4900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030200 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f1 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8c88 is the less saturated color, while #f9ac1d is the most saturated one.
